An updated, redesigned collection of hundreds of quotes from Berkshire Hathaway chairman and CEO Warren Buffett on business, politics, taxes, life, and more. Part of the In Their Own Words series.
For more than half a century, Warren Buffett, the chairman and CEO of Berkshire Hathaway, has been one of the world's most respected businessmen, not just because of his savvy investments and unmatched record of returns, but also because of his humility, candour, and refreshing perspective on wealth.
Despite this tremendous success, the Oracle of Omaha doesn't feel entitled to the $89 billion net worth his abilities have earned him. Instead, he likes to say that he was born at the right place and time, and as an active philanthropist, he has already pledged to give most of his money to charity. This modesty in the face of proven talent is part of what makes Buffett as popular on Main Street as he is on Wall Street - he is one of the world's wealthiest men and yet he is still personable and relatable.
Now, hundreds of the most thought-provoking and inspiring quotes from Buffett are compiled in a single book. Warren Buffett: In His Own Words is a comprehensive guidebook to the inner workings of this business icon, providing insight into his thoughts on investing, Wall Street, business, politics, taxes, life lessons, and more.
This collection of quotations draws from decades of interviews, editorials, and annual shareholder reports, amassing a comprehensive outline of how Buffett believes a good business is run and a good life is led. It's advice that Buffett has successfully adhered to throughout his 88 years, and it's now available in Warren Buffett: In His Own Words.
